The Veterans Health Administration (VHA) has a requirement at the Long Beach VA Medical Center, located at 5901 E 7th Street, Long Beach, CA 90822, for fuel filtering/tank cleaning & lab testing for (15) Underground Fuel Storage Tanks (STU). STATEMENT OF WORK Fuel Filtering/Tank Cleaning & Lab Testing for Fifteen (15) Underground Fuel Storage Tanks. 1. Background: The Long Beach VA Healthcare System requires a qualified contractor to perform fuel filtering/tank cleaning and lab testing. The underground fuel storage tanks contain fuel for the emergency generators which provide power for each building throughout the medical center when normal power is interrupted. Tanks must be kept free from debris and water in order to operate the emergency generators safely and properly. All emergency generators depend on the fuel in these underground fuel storage tanks. The availability of reliable emergency power in the event of normal power is imperative to the care of critically ill patients, especially those on life support. Filtration ensures a clean dependable fuel source for the operation of the emergency generators. 2. Scope: Contractor shall provide all labor, parts, materials, equipment, and Supervision required to perform all work required to perform Annual Fuel Filtering/Tank Cleaning & Lab Testing on all Fifteen Underground Fuel Storage Tanks. 2.1. Contractor and Employees shall report to the VA Engineering point of contact, Keith Didrickson, for the issuing of Temporary ID Badges from the VA Police Department, that are to be always worn while on VA Property. 3. Contractor Requirements: 3.1. Supervisor: 30 Hour OSHA Construction Safety Training. 3.2. Personnel: 10 Hour OSHA Construction Safety Training. 4. Specific Tasks: Contractor shall set up at each tank location with their truck and all necessary equipment to filter all the fuel in the Underground Fuel Storage Tanks to remove all sediment, debris and perform proper disposal of same. Underground tanks will be left clean and free of any contaminants that could affect the Operation of the Emergency Generators. Contractor shall then test the tanks to ensure the removal of all sediment, debris and contaminants. When the testing is complete, the Contractor shall provide the COR with a written report for final approval. 5. List of Tanks and Gallons to be Filtered: 5.1. LB-1: 550 Gallons of Red Diesel. 5.2. LB-2: Ten Thousand Gallons of Red Diesel. 5.3. LB-3: Four Thousand Gallons of Red diesel. 5.4. LB-4: Six Thousand Gallons of Red Diesel. 5.5. LB-5: Six Thousand Gallons of Unleaded Fuel. 5.6. LB-6: Ten Thousand Gallons of Unleaded Fu 5.7. LB-7: Two Thousand Gallons of Red Diesel. 5.8. LB-9A: Thirty Thousand Gallons of Low Nox Diesel. 5.9. LB-9B: Thirty Thousand Gallons of Low Nox Diesel. 5.10. LB-9C: Thirty Thousand Gallons of Low Nox Diesel. 5.11. LB-9D: Thirty Thousand Gallons of Low Nox Diesel. 5.12. LB-12: Six Thousand Six Gallons of Red Diesel. 5.13. LB-14: Two Thousand Gallons of Red Diesel. 5.14. LB-15: One Thousand Five Hundred Gallons of Red Diesel. 5.15. LB-22: Five Thousand Eight Hundred Gallons of Red Diesel. 6. Performance Monitoring: Routine inspections by Facilities Personnel.
